I use a EV120 and love it. I have removed the air intake ball valve so that the skimmer can pull as much air as possible. I also changed the pump to using an Eheim 1260 pump. I get really nasty coffee color skimmage from this setup. I also have it mounted outside my sump as of right now. I am getting about 8oz of skimmage every two to three days. Though I am about to rework my plumbing and hope to give the skimmer pump more raw overflow water, so hopefully that will increase the amount of skimmage I am producing.

I have an AquaC EV-120 and I love it.

However, I didn't always love it. My injector was calcified for a long time and I never figured out why the skimming performance was so bad. Also, I used to have it mounted in my sump and the water level would rise too high.

Now that I have it plumbed externally with a PVC pipe returning the flow to the sump, it is very quiet and pulls lots of great skimmate without any fuss.

I'm running an in-sump EV-120 on a 120g bare bottom SPS tank and so far it has not disappointed me.
I do however have it tee'd off of my sump return pump with a gate valve to control the flow. If I had to guess, the flow is probably in the 700-800 gph range. That being said, I would think the recommended Mag 5 would be underpowered for this skimmer.
I do use a 100 micron filter sock on the gate valve output cause with the increased flow, you end up with microbubbles.
